    This a bakery located at Champlain Sqare that's located right across from Independent Grocer. They have a large variety of breads, cakes, pastries, and various other baked goods, all very reasonably priced. I had their Boston Cream Cake, Raspberry Cheesecake Slice, Chocolate Mousse Cake, Long John, Beef Sausage Roll, and Ham & Cheese Croissant. The food was quite good; I particularly enjoyed their mousse cake and ham & cheese croissant. This is a bakery that I'd recommend checking out.

    Boston Cream Cake ($1.65):
    3.5/5
    The cake was quite soft, tender and moist. I enjoyed the chocolate glaze on top that provided a nice bittersweet flavour. I do wish that there can be more of the custard filling.

    Raspberry Cheesecake Slice ($1.95):
    3/5
    The cake was quite light and soft. I did find it to be slightly bland on its own. The raspberry swirl provided some sweetness, although I do wish it would be a bit more tart.

    Chocolate Mousse Cake ($3.65):
    4/5
    The cake was very soft and moist. The mousses were smooth and light, and had a really nice flavour, while the layer of chocolate on top melted in my mouth and wasn't at all waxy.

    Long John ($1.65):
    3.5/5
    The donut was quite light and fluffy, with a slightly chewy texture. The chocolate glaze was not waxy and had a nice bittersweet chocolate flavour.

    Beef Sausage Roll ($2.35):
    3.5/5
    The crust outside was relatively flaky with a nice flavour. I quite enjoyed the sausage inside, which was tender and savoury.

    Ham and Cheese Croissant ($2.35):
    3.5/5
    The croissant itself was quite buttery. The cheese provided a great bit of richness while the ham provided a nice flavour.
